Lentswe, Jouberton - A local NPO, Untold Stories from Kasi, is trying to help the community. Ono Nyali founded the NPO. Together with Alex Thobela and Tshepo Mafaesa, they organized a Youth Boxing Tournament to bring the community together. They used the money raised from the entrance tickets to make a difference.

They managed to buy school shoes for three children and provide 10 food parcels to struggling families.

“I’m passionate about teaching people kindness. Even though I am also going through a lot personally, I believe in helping others where I can. This was not just about boxing, but about hope, unity, and action,” said Nyali.

“We want to show that you don’t need to be rich to make a difference - just willing,” he said.
